Mallards re-sign versatile Follmer

MOLINE, Ill. – The Quad City Mallards have re-signed forward/defenseman Kyle Follmer for the 2016-17 season.

The Mallards are the ECHL affiliate of the National Hockey League's Minnesota Wild and the American Hockey League's Iowa Wild.

Follmer scored 16 points (7g-9a) in 41 games after joining the Mallards last November. The St. Paul, Minn. native started last season with the Allen Americans, where he appeared in three games.

As a rookie in 2014-15, Follmer scored 18 points (10g-8a) in 45 games with the Americans. He skated in four playoff games as Allen claimed the 2015 Kelly Cup title.

Follmer, who did not play during the 2013-14 campaign due to injury, spent four seasons at Northern Michigan University before turning professional. He scored 67 points (15g-52a) in 152 career collegiate games. He enjoyed his most productive season as a Wildcat when he produced a team-leading 22 assists and recorded 26 points as a junior in 2012-13.

Follmer arrived at NMU after three junior seasons in the United States Hockey League with first the Sioux City Musketeers and then the Lincoln Stars.
